New Hampshire AO-85 Consent to Exercise Adjudgeddg— - Federal District Court Official Form is an essential legal document used in the federal district court of New Hampshire. This form serves as consent for parties involved in a case to exercise the jurisdiction of a magistrate judge within the court system. It grants the magistrate judge the authority to hear and decide on specific matters related to the case. The New Hampshire AO-85 Consent to Exercise Adjudgeddg— - Federal District Court Official Form is a crucial document that outlines the consent process and ensures that all parties involved are aware of and agree to the jurisdiction of the magistrate judge. By signing this form, the parties acknowledge their consent and waive the right to have the matter heard by a district judge. Your decision should be communicated to the United States District Clerk's Office. Consent forms are available in the Clerk's office. Your consent to trial by a Magistrate Judge must be voluntary, and you are free to withhold consent without suffering any adverse consequences. Magistrate judges are appointed by judges of the district court for a term of eight years. They may dispose of minor criminal offenses and may hold bench or jury trials in civil actions on consent of the parties.
